Sphere to sphere transforms in spectral space in the cycle 46t1r1 of ARPEGE/IFS: configuration 911.
Article published on 12 February 2019

by Karim Yessad

Abstract:

This documentation describes configuration formerly numbered 911 which performs dilatation/contraction matrices: these matrices allow to do spectral transformation between a stretched spectral space and between its unstretched counterpart. Some algorithmic aspects and technical aspects are described. Some namelists are provided to use the configuration 911, which is now externalised in the project UTILITIES. Such transformations can be used in spherical geometry only, and for METEO-FRANCE purpose only (not at ECMWF).
